Transaction d6898af43e668b4db64b641e1d2911dbefce8e75e34f74a366239f3c0fdcd93a
1 Input
1 Output
-
d6898af43e668b4db64b641e1d2911dbefce8e75e34f74a366239f3c0fdcd93a:0
- value
- 8699045
- script pubkey
- OP_0 OP_PUSHBYTES_20 dbf83b31d0f0efb3cdaca09ce950acf58856d09a
- address
- bc1qm0urkvws7rhm8ndv5zwwj59v7ky9d5y623ytqe